Cannot sign out of iCloud do to restrictions

I cannot sign out of my daughters iCloud account so I can log back into my iCloud. I got a new phone and not all my contacts transferred to my new phone.

Screen Time is the Culprit:


I. Disable Screen Time:

  1. Go to: Settings
  2. Tap: Screen Time
  3. Tap: Turn Off Screen Time(so that it is greyed-out)


II. Forgot the Password?
